Siri's Makeover

The updated Siri is a far cry from its former self. Apple has transformed it into a powerful AI tool, capable of accessing device information, understanding user context, and providing answers grounded in world knowledge. This evolution is a direct response to the rise of AI chatbots like ChatGPT and Gemini, and Apple is positioning Siri as a worthy competitor.

Seamless Integration

What's impressive is Siri's deep integration into the operating system. Users can now access Siri through various methods, including voice commands, button presses, and even swiping gestures. Its integration with the iPhone's search engine, Spotlight, enhances its capabilities, making it a more integral part of the user experience.

Under the Hood: Apple Intelligence

At the core of Siri's transformation is Apple Intelligence, a powerful suite of AI capabilities. Apple's collaboration with Google on Foundation Models is noteworthy, but they've tailored these models specifically for Apple Silicon. This ensures optimal performance and privacy, as data remains secure within the device's Private Cloud Compute.

Early Impressions

Initial tests reveal a more capable Siri, adept at handling everyday tasks and providing relevant information. It can summarize texts, add appointments, and even offer nutritional insights. However, as with any beta, there are hiccups, like Siri searching contacts for news-related queries. These are minor growing pains in Siri's journey to becoming an indispensable digital companion.
